About Mark

Mark Olexa offers focused therapy for a range of life challenges, including personal and spiritual growth, relationship concerns, emotional regulation, mood swings, addictions, and other life-controlling issues. He adapts his approach to each person's needs, blending motivational counseling, cognitive behavioral therapy, and reality therapy to support practical change and improved coping.

His work centers on individual counseling - often referred to as talk therapy - and includes substance use disorder recovery planning and relapse prevention skills when appropriate. He also helps clients clarify decisions, set achievable goals, and use homework exercises to reinforce progress outside sessions. When clients face significant legal, financial, medical, or other matters beyond his scope, he makes referrals to independent professionals who can address those specific needs.

Mark holds the credential LMSW, which stands for Licensed Master Social Worker, reflecting formal training in social work and clinical practice. His method emphasizes collaboration, skill-building, and strategies that fit each client's situation and objectives.

Therapeutic Approaches for Online Care

Mark Olexa uses approaches that translate well to remote sessions and focus on practical change.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es the client's own perspective and priorities, creating a supportive environment where the therapist reflects and clarifies to help the person move toward their goals.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on identifying and changing unhelpful thoughts and behaviors, offering concrete strategies for managing anxiety, depression, and stress. Motivational Interviewing is a collaborative method for strengthening motivation and commitment to change, especially useful for addictions and behavior change.

Choosing the right approach is part of the therapeutic process. Mark works collaboratively with each person to determine which methods best match their needs, goals, and preferences, and adjusts the plan as progress unfolds.
